Largest Sunspot in 24 Years Returns for 2nd Month
Last month, Sunspot Active Region 2192 (AR-2192)  was more than ten times the size of the Earth, when it rivaled the October 23 Solar Eclipse in prominence. This month, the sunspot, re-numbered AR-2209, continues to be active, with several intense M-class Solar Flares.
